Camry False Check Engine Light From Gas Cap
Camry Beware if the gas cap is loose, or the seal is compromised the check engine light will come on, and when tested will give a code for Oxygen Sensor. Tightening the cap may resolve the issue, or purchasing a new cap at any auto store.
It makes me wonder how many poor souls took their Camry to the dealer and paid $300 for a new sensor when it was just the gas cap, and of course, I'm sure the dealers are well aware of this anomaly. Always check the basics before paying for an expensive fix, perhaps someone here on the forums might have the simple, and inexpensive answer to your issue. You asked for it, you got it, Toyota! Re: Camry False Check Engine Light From Gas Cap
The code for a loose gas cap is P0440. This is not a false Check Engine Light, but a meaningful code for a defective (or loose) cap and other types of evaporative emission system leaks. See this post in the FAQ thread for descriptions of the codes and some causes.
